I'm trying to weigh up the pros and cons of getting a Carsoft multiplexer as opposed to letting my dealer charge me the same amount to plug my car in for a single diagnostic.



Does anyone know whether the Carsoft shows all codes that the Star does, or is there a good reason to get the dealer to plug it into Star?


If you get the geniune Carsoft... which cost a couple thousand, it will work as claimed.

If you buy the ebay cheap Carsoft, it does work somewhat...

If you buy the Star on ebay... it is expensive but is same as the dealer... just older. Cost about the same as genuine carsoft.

Alot of time for engine trouble, OBD2 scanner is all you need. Really.... unless you are a super tech, Star and Carsoft is nothing more than a super fancy OBD2 scanner.
